Output 72ef661d07c1a9792d4b10a99c59623260ee30caccdb5e14ae92f853470cb5cd:74

value
2651892
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2e909b5f72d57b12d9dfcc49c6b7643b47d29c1f7dbced44dcd46aeecb3a9e36
address
bc1p96gfkhmj64a39kwle3yuddmy8dra98ql0k7w63xu634waje6ncmqe7alh8
transaction
72ef661d07c1a9792d4b10a99c59623260ee30caccdb5e14ae92f853470cb5cd
spent
true